pkgsrc-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[pkgsrc/trunk]: pkgsrc/misc/dotfile Fixed "test ==" and PKGMANDIR. CHECK_INTE...



details:   https://anonhg.NetBSD.org/pkgsrc/rev/2be86b1ceadb
branches:  trunk
changeset: 521751:2be86b1ceadb
user:      rillig <rillig%pkgsrc.org@localhost>
date:      Sun Nov 19 22:48:07 2006 +0000

description:
Fixed "test ==" and PKGMANDIR. CHECK_INTERPRETER and CHECK_PERMS still
complain.

diffstat:

 misc/dotfile/Makefile         |  12 ++++++++----
 misc/dotfile/distinfo         |   3 ++-
 misc/dotfile/patches/patch-ac |  24 ++++++++++++++++++++++++
 3 files changed, 34 insertions(+), 5 deletions(-)

diffs (68 lines):

diff -r b047b57b79ab -r 2be86b1ceadb misc/dotfile/Makefile
--- a/misc/dotfile/Makefile     Sun Nov 19 22:36:20 2006 +0000
+++ b/misc/dotfile/Makefile     Sun Nov 19 22:48:07 2006 +0000
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.27 2006/02/14 01:01:17 rillig Exp $
+# $NetBSD: Makefile,v 1.28 2006/11/19 22:48:07 rillig Exp $
 
 DISTNAME=      dotfile-2.4.1
 PKGREVISION=   2
@@ -20,10 +20,14 @@
 
 GNU_CONFIGURE= yes
 NO_BUILD=      yes
+MAKE_FLAGS+=   mandir=${PREFIX}/${PKGMANDIR}/man1
+
+post-build:
+       rm -f ${WRKSRC}/Generator/makeHelp
 
 post-install:
-       ${INSTALL_DATA_DIR} ${PREFIX:Q}/share/doc/${PKGNAME_NOREV:Q}
-       cd ${WRKSRC:Q}/Doc && ${PAX} -rw . ${PREFIX:Q}/share/doc/${PKGNAME_NOREV:Q}
-       ${CHOWN} -R ${ROOT_USER}:${ROOT_GROUP} ${PREFIX:Q}/share/doc/${PKGNAME_NOREV:Q}
+       ${INSTALL_DATA_DIR} ${PREFIX}/share/doc/${PKGNAME_NOREV}
+       cd ${WRKSRC:Q}/Doc && ${PAX} -rw -s ',.*\.orig$$,,' . ${PREFIX}/share/doc/${PKGNAME_NOREV}
+       ${CHOWN} -R ${ROOT_USER}:${ROOT_GROUP} ${PREFIX}/share/doc/${PKGNAME_NOREV}
 
 .include "../../mk/bsd.pkg.mk"
diff -r b047b57b79ab -r 2be86b1ceadb misc/dotfile/distinfo
--- a/misc/dotfile/distinfo     Sun Nov 19 22:36:20 2006 +0000
+++ b/misc/dotfile/distinfo     Sun Nov 19 22:48:07 2006 +0000
@@ -1,7 +1,8 @@
-$NetBSD: distinfo,v 1.3 2005/02/24 11:02:51 agc Exp $
+$NetBSD: distinfo,v 1.4 2006/11/19 22:48:07 rillig Exp $
 
 SHA1 (dotfile-2.4.1.tar.gz) = dfbd922ec6c0f34b41a0ec78276f222621bf1c05
 RMD160 (dotfile-2.4.1.tar.gz) = 3f09a022e75f3b0b5fa9ef77769e70ef78a75b05
 Size (dotfile-2.4.1.tar.gz) = 1015756 bytes
 SHA1 (patch-aa) = 0b17889ba0a5dca52b01614777092096e86e4306
 SHA1 (patch-ab) = 6730793b2b479c2a4df0df1337dccc30780bb140
+SHA1 (patch-ac) = 2696b9d570b3d1e1dc3ac5a8f4f73fde17fbafe7
diff -r b047b57b79ab -r 2be86b1ceadb misc/dotfile/patches/patch-ac
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/misc/dotfile/patches/patch-ac     Sun Nov 19 22:48:07 2006 +0000
@@ -0,0 +1,24 @@
+$NetBSD: patch-ac,v 1.1 2006/11/19 22:48:08 rillig Exp $
+
+--- Generator/makeHelp.orig    2000-02-19 20:15:36.000000000 +0100
++++ Generator/makeHelp 2006-10-24 01:56:01.000000000 +0200
+@@ -1,14 +1,13 @@
+ #! /bin/sh
+-if [ "$2" == "" ]; then
++
++if [ $# -ne 2 -a $# -ne 3 ]; then
++   exec 1>&2
+    echo "syntax makeHelp <Generator Path> <module help file> [<language>]"
+    echo "The language defaults to english"
++   exit 1
+ fi    
+ 
+-if [ "$3" == "" ]; then
+-    language=english
+-else
+-    language=$3
+-fi
++language=${3-english}
+ 
+ cp $1/help.$language.html helpfile.data
+ echo "\n\n<h1>---------------</h1>" >> helpfile.data



Home | Main Index | Thread Index | Old Index